Knee and ... Webb30 mars 2024 · Bodyweight squat. Squats are one of the best exercises to strengthen the muscles around your knees. Squats help to strengthen your hamstrings, quadriceps and glutes. Stand upright with your feet hip-width apart and your toes pointing forwards. With your back straight, chest out, and shoulders back and down, slowly squat downwards.
